George Wallace      Be it remembered that the following Bill of sale
Ex.d   from   60       was recorded on the 19 day of February in the year
Susan Tubman         1851.  To wit:
                               Know all men by these presents that I, Susan
Tubman, of Dorchester County and State of Maryland, for and in consideration
of the sum of Two hundred and fifty dollars, current money, to me
in hand paid by George Wallace, of the County & State aforesaid, at and
before the sealing & delivery of these presents, the receipt whereof is hereby
acknowledged, the said Susan Tubman hath bargained & sold, transfered
and delivered, and by these presents doth bargain & sell, transfer & deliver,
unto the said George Wallace, his heirs and Assigns forever, one Negro
Man, named Joe, aged about forty five years, and a slave for life.
To have and to hold the said Negro Man, named Joe, a slave for life,
unto the said George Wallace, his heirs and Assigns forever, against me
the said Susan Tubman and my heirs, and against all persons whatsoever,
to the only proper use of the said George Wallace, his heirs & Assigns
forever, and for no other use, intent or purpose whatsoever.  In witness
whereof the said Susan Tubman has hereunto subscribed her name and
affixed her seal this 19.th day of February in the year of Our Lord one
thousand eight hundred and fifty one.
Signed, sealed & delivered in the presence of      Susan Tubman   (Seal)
Test      Charles Corkran

Maryland, Dorchester County ss.  On this 19 day of February in the
year 1851, personally appeared Susan Tubman, before the subscriber a Justice
of the Peace for the County and state aforesaid, and acknowledged the above
Bill of sale to be her Act and deed, and delivered the same for the uses
and purposes therein mentioned, according to the Act of Assembly in such
case made & provided:  At the same time appeared before me, George
Wallace, party grantee within named, and made Oath on the Holy
Evangely of Almighty God that the consideration mentioned in the aforegoing
Bill of sale is true and bona fide as therein set forth.
Acknowledged & sworn before            Charles Corkran

1851 February 19.th Rec.d one dollar in lieu of a stamp on this Bill
of sale.                                                                  Wm Jackson   Clk

1851 Octo 22d Deld to George Wallace
